Raheny Age Friendly June Coffee Morning

There was 64 people in attendance this month, and it was great to welcome in some new faces.

Our guest speaker this month was local historian, active member of Raheny Heritage Society and author of St Anne’s.The Story of a Guinness Estate, Joan Sharke.

Raheny Pic 1

She gave a really interesting presentation on the history of St Anne’s Park and the significant involvement of the Guinness family in its development. Joan’s book is sadly out of publication and a copy is available in Raheny Library.
